Overview

2004 Broom 42CL for sale

Penned from the drawing board of legendary naval architect Andrew Wolstenholme, the Broom 42CL gives you the widest cruising potential without compromising on seaworthiness. It is a great cruising boat, whether on the inland waterways due to her low air draft capability or out at sea. Offering sumptuous accommodation for 6 in 2 separate cabins and dinette conversion, she is ideal for spending extended periods of time on board.

"Freya" has been thoroughly enjoyed and has cruised extensively around the UK, Ireland and much of mainland Europe. Fitted with the biggest Yanmar 440hp engines, she offers good offshore cruising potential. Extensively equipped as you would expect from a boat from this renowned British yard.

Accommodation

SLEEPS UP TO SIX IN TWO SUMPTUOUS CABINS PLUS DINETTE CONVERSION
The interior is finished in Cherry with a silk finish
Blackout curtains throughout with matching cushions
New cockpit upholstery (2020)
New carpet and vinyl (2019)

AFT CABIN: 5' double berth. Two large escape hatches with flyscreens and black-out blinds. Six drawers. Seven cupboards. Two wardrobes. Two shoe lockers and under berth stowage, reading lights and mirror.
EN-SUITE: Electric toilet and wash basin, mirrored cupboards and under sink cupboard. Separate shower compartment with seat, extractor fan and dry locker.
LOBBY: With large storage cupboard and hanging rails and hooks.
SALOON: U-shaped seating to starboard (customised to allow additional external visibility) around an adjustable Besenzoni dining table allowing seating for up to eight (using stools), under seat stowage plus chart drawer. To port, a run of cupboards including wiring for a TV, wine racks and Radio / CD player. Steps up to aft cockpit and side steps to port deck. Additional sofa.
DINETTE: Clock & Barometer with cupboards either side of dinette bookshelf. Further storage under forward dinette seat.
GALLEY: Gas oven, 3-burner gas hob, extractor fan and hob light. Microwave oven and refrigerator. 1.5 sink with mixer tap fitted in to plenty of Avonite work surface. Pan drawer, large under sink cupboard floor locker. Cutlery drawer. 2kw inverter allowing use of electric kettle.
GUEST CABIN: V berth with drawers underneath, two single wardrobes, a mirrored locker, a single drawer and a shoe locker. Reading light to each berth and an oddments shelf all around. Roof escape hatch with flyscreen and black out blinds.
GUEST EN-SUITE: Manual toilet, wash basin and shower. Mirrored lockers. Holding tank gauge.

Two Webasto heating units with outlets to both cabins, saloon, dinette and cockpit
Frigomar - CL533 16KBTU/h 230/1/50-60 air conditioning - using variable DC motor allowing running off Mastervolt generator (consumption circa 6 amps without cold start)
A/C outlets in saloon and aft cabin with saloon controller
